‘Lost’ star is inspired by Hawaii “Lost” actress Michelle Rodriguez says she treats people with respect – unless provoked. “My family taught me about ethics and the importance of respecting everybody,” Rodriguez tells People en Español magazine in its debut “New Hollywood” issue. “But, if someone is disrespectful to me, then we have a problem.” Rodriguez, 27, who plays Ana Lucia Cortez on the ABC castaway drama, is on one of four celebrity covers of the “New Hollywood” issue, on newsstands Feb. 6. |

'Lost' mystery: Why is Hurley still fat? When the plane first crashed on the ABC drama "Lost" and deposited its surviving passengers on an island, lottery winner Hurley (portrayed by Jorge Garcia) had the pudgy physique — and then some — of the Skipper on Gilligan's Island. After 50 days away from fast food and Western comforts, guess what? He's still the size of three Gilligans. But stay tuned; this could end up in the script. Innovative TV series finds a huge fan base Word has spread even among nonviewers: Lost, the ABC hit television series, is addictive. "I've got friends who will cover their ears and close their eyes when they walk through their living rooms if it's on," says Anna Ward, 27, a Jackson attorney. "They're scared if they see or hear anything, they'll be hooked." Millions of Americans already are. Lost, which is filmed on the Hawaiian island of Oahu, ranks as the fourth most-watched prime-time program. ‘Lost’ actor reaches ‘pinnacle’ One of the actors of the ABC series “Lost” left behind his star power to promote a different type of strength among local lawmakers — harmony and hope. Dressed in a simple gray suit draped with a single strand of maile leaves, Adewale Akinnuoye- Agbaje, a devout Buddhist, quietly delivered the traditional daily prayer before the state Senate on Wednesday.
